There is a place I go, that is deep inside of me, I go there to listen, to reflect, to remember. This place doesn’t have a location, I call it the space in-between.

In Tantrik philosophy it is referred to as the Madhya Space. It’s the space between breath, the intermittent silent silence between the in-breath and the out-breath, it is the place between sounds, before one sensory sound merges into the other, it is the millisecond between each heartbeat, it’s subtleness so soft, it feels almost as unreachable as melting due.
